SUBJECT: MAGICAL MIKE AND THE INCREDIBLE BLISS BROTHERS COMING TO C OF O
By: Stephanie Bell
For those interested in an evening of entertainment, “Magical Mike Bliss and the Incredible Bliss Brothers” might be the perfect fit for you. College of the Ozarks will host this performance on Tuesday, Oct. 20, at 7 p.m. in the Jones Auditorium as part of the fall 2009 convocation series.
For over 20 years, Mike Bliss has been performing shows featuring magic tricks, juggling, unicycling, and pick-pocketing antics before audiences nationwide. His two sons Zachary (10) and Stephen (9) join him with their impressive Mind Reading Act, making them the youngest magicians in the US. Zachary is also one of the youngest jugglers in the country.
Bliss and his sons appeared on NBC’s “America’s Got Talent” in 2007 and made it to the top 35 out of 100,000 acts. Bliss has performed at the World Famous Magic Castle in Hollywood, was voted Branson’s Specialty Act of the Year in 2003, and currently performs in Branson at the Brett Family Theater and in the Joey Reilly Comedy Show.
